A car moves when filled with fuel and the engine is started by the driver. It changes direction on its own when the steering whe

el is moved by the driver. Is the car living or non-living? Justify your answer
Science
Biology
2 answers:
Luden [163]2 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Car is non-living. It does show movement but that is by the application of external force. It cannot grow as living organisms do nor it can respire like other living organisms. Car changes its direction when the driver rotates the steering otherwise it cannot do so on its own.
